Squalicum Creek near Mouth at Bellingham, WA

Squalicum Creek near Mouth at Bellingham, WA is USGS streamgage 12204010 in Washington, monitoring river discharge in hydrologic subbasin 17110004. It drains a watershed of about 23 square miles. Discharge records at this site go back to 2022. Typical flow runs near 0.7 cfs in July and 18.7 cfs in April, with the higher of the two arriving in April. When does Squalicum Creek near Mouth at Bellingham, WA normally run highest?
December, on the long-term record. The median daily flow that month is about 58.8 cfs, against 0.6 cfs in August, the lowest month. These are historical normals for the date, not a forecast and not today's reading.
